Baker Loses Work Money in Late-Night Online Bets.
A baker tried to get rich quickly but lost his work money instead. William Gonese took $3,420 from his night shift at the Bakers Inn store to bet online.
The 28-year-old shift boss wanted to win big on a betting game called Aviator. He hoped to pay back the store money and keep extra cash for his new wife.
"I meant to win, not steal," Gonese told the court. He lives in Chitungwiza, near Harare. He said he started with $350 but kept betting until all the money was gone. "My girlfriend just moved in with me. I wanted to make her proud."
The trouble started last Saturday night. The store gave him money to run the shop on Chinhoyi Street. By three in the morning, Gonese had to make a hard call. He phoned his boss, Yusufu Bruce, and told the truth.
The money included $470 in cash and $2,950 in shop credits called InnBucks. Bruce checked the books. The whole amount was gone.
The store called the police after they found the missing money. They caught Gonese right away. He faces the judge today for his sentence.
The case shows how betting can lead to wrongdoing. It left a worker in trouble and a store without cash. Judge Lynne Chinzou will decide what happens next.
